欧姆龙PLC与Fanuc机器人之间的Ethernet IP通讯是一种高效的数据传输方式,可以实现快速、稳定的数据交换。在进行通讯之前,需要确保两台设备都支持Ethernet IP通讯,并且已经安装了相应的通讯软件。以下是具体的连接步骤:
- 配置欧姆龙PLC:
在CX-Programmer软件中创建一个新的PLC项目,并进行以下设置:
- 在“I/O”表中双击“内置Ethernet IP模块”,进入IP地址设置界面。根据实际情况设置Ethernet IP单元号和节点号,并确保这些数值与Fanuc机器人设置一致。
- 在“PLC符号表”内建立网络变量。定义好网络变量名及对应的地址,如果是多通道的数组,可以点击“高级设置”进入设置数组长度。请注意,PLC内设置的是通道,但是在Ethernet IP上是以Byte为单位计算交换字节数的,1CH=2Byte。
- 配置Fanuc机器人:
对于已经支持Ethernet IP通讯的Fanuc机器人(如R-30iB Mate柜或R-30iB机器人电柜),可以按照以下步骤进行配置:
- 打开机器人的控制柜门,找到内置的网口。确保网口连接正常,并且已经安装了Ethernet IP通讯软件。
- 根据实际需要,在机器人的IO表中设置相应的Ethernet IP参数,包括IP地址、子网掩码、网关等。确保这些参数与欧姆龙PLC的设置一致。
- 连接测试:
完成上述配置后,可以进行连接测试以验证通讯是否正常。在CX-Programmer软件中启动Network Configurator For Ethernet IP,或者在CX-One内启动。将CJ2H-CPU68-EIP模块添加到Ethernet IP网络上,并右键模块修改模块的IP地址。确保模块的IP地址与欧姆龙PLC和Fanuc机器人的IP地址在同一网段内。 - 数据传输测试:
完成连接测试后,可以在欧姆龙PLC和Fanuc机器人之间进行数据传输测试。在CX-Programmer软件中,通过内置Ethernet IP模块发送数据到Fanuc机器人,检查是否能够正常接收数据。同时,也可以在Fanuc机器人上发送数据到欧姆龙PLC,检查是否能够正常接收数据。 - 注意事项:
- 在进行配置之前,请确保两台设备都支持Ethernet IP通讯,并且已经安装了相应的通讯软件。
- 在设置IP地址时,要确保IP地址在同一网段内,并且没有与其他设备冲突。
- 在进行数据传输测试时,要确保数据格式正确,并且符合通讯协议的要求。
- 如果遇到连接问题或数据传输问题,可以检查设备的网口连接、通讯软件版本、驱动程序等是否正确安装和配置。
通过以上步骤,您应该能够成功地实现欧姆龙PLC与Fanuc机器人之间的Ethernet IP通讯。在实际应用中,请根据具体情况进行相应的调整和优化。